Output dbfcc8d77dab6f7436d1c5ef63e7926bc5c0aec37eb2e2b22b30e20a593f29f9:41

value
42858
script pubkey
OP_0 OP_PUSHBYTES_20 5ecec3d879c74968febd35b8f0957556c0acd26d
address
bc1qtm8v8krecayk3l4axku0p9t42mq2e5ndnzz7r3
transaction
dbfcc8d77dab6f7436d1c5ef63e7926bc5c0aec37eb2e2b22b30e20a593f29f9
confirmations
25590
spent
true